webMethods Knowlegebase : [BRM.10.1025] JMS: Invalid property name "JMSXRcvTimestamp" (1782772)

Troubleshooting


Problem

Broker throws the following error when attempting to publish a message that is received from WebSphere:

[BRM.10.1025] JMS: Invalid property name "JMSXRcvTimestamp". JMS reserves the JMSX property name prefix for JMS defined properties.

This issue occurs because the incoming message contains several optional ‘JMSX’ properties that are not supported in Broker.

Instead of ignoring the properties, Broker throws an error incorrectly.
